#98aecd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#98aecd is composed of 59.6% red, 68.2%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.9% cyan, 15.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 215.1 degrees, a saturation of 34.6% and a lightness of 70%. #98aecd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#315d9b.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#98aecd color description : Slightly desaturated blue.

#98aecd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#98aecd has RGB values of R:152, G:174,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 10006221.

Shades and Tints of #98aecd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f4f7fa is the lightest one.
